South Burnett Saints tested second-placed Coolaroo in their Round 17 Darling Downs AFL game played at Lyle Vidler Oval in Kingaroy on Saturday.

The home team shot out of the gates, kicking four goals to nil in the first quarter to lead 4.5-29 to 0.3-3 at the first change.

But the Roos, who have lost just three matches this season, changed gears in the second stanza to lead 8.4-52 to 4.6-30 at half-time.

When the final siren sounded, Coolaroo were ahead 16.11-107 to 8.9-57.

South Burnett goals were kicked by Jarryd Hill (3), Benjamin Smith (2), Keegan Wright, Shaun Pukallus and William Packer.

The Saints’ last game for the season will be played on Saturday at Rockville Oval in Toowoomba against the Toowoomba Tigers.
